As far as I know all of my builds *could* be made, provided Lego made pieces in the right colors. You'd just need to be *very* careful with how you displayed/moved some, as they'd fall apart if you tilted them the wrong way.
For better or worse I settled on a scale early on (1 plate thickness = ~0.762m) and have tried to stick with that for almost everything.
It would be neat to do Trophy-scale like @celeryensign.bsky.social does, but that would make a lot of pre-made cylinder pieces unavailable at larger scales.

I thought they'd be black to maximize emissivity, but it turns out there are a bunch of materials that have great emissivity in IR *and* low absorptivity in visible light.
So they still put out waste heat, but without absorbing a bunch of heat from sunlight.
